2) To get this, let's define each thing:

Acute triangle - Means that all the angles in triangle are acute, which means they are less than 90 degrees in measure.

Obtuse triangle - Means that one angle in the triangle is obtuse, which means it is greater than 90 degrees in measure.

Scalene triangle - All the sides of the triangle are different in size/length

Isosceles triangle - 2 sides of the triangle are the same length

A scale drawing shows a room to be 3 inches by 4-1/2 inches. carpet, which is $15 per square yard, is to be installed in the roo
Alja [10]
The first thing we must do for this case is to look for the real dimensions.
 We have then:
 (3) * (4) = 12 feet
 (4-1 / 2) * (4) = 18 feet
 We are now looking for the room area:
 (12) * (18) = 216 feet ^ 2
 We consider the following conversion:
 1 yard = 3 feet
 Applying the conversion:
 (216) * (1/3) ^ 2 = 24 yd ^ 2
 The total cost will then be:
 (24) * (15) = 360 $
 Answer:
 
it would cost to install the carpet about:
 
360 $
